Your situation and circumstances is almost identical to mine.
To answer your question yes there was a recent change that caused many revocations and denials in recent years, on June of 2019 the OIG released a report titled "CBP's Global Entry Program Is Vulnerable to Exploitation"
w.oig.dhs.gov/sites/default/files/assets/2019-06/OIG-19-49-Jun19.pdf

I believe this triggered some internal policies changes that caused many participants to be revoked and denied sometimes for no real reason.
In your case since they stated the reason is a Customs or Agriculture violation(s). I would submit a FOIA request and when it comes back showing no violations submit the results and appeal to the CBP Ombudsman.
